Find and replace part of a text string
 
Help! I've been trying to figure out a formula for the following
problem, but I'm stumped. I have about 2,000 names such as the
following beginning in cell A1:

Scott Jameson
MMSHRL Llc
Hum Investments Ltd
El Marcelago, Llc
Lars Property Investments Llc

I want to find all the "Llc" and replace it with "LLC".

Scott Jameson
MMSHRL LLC
Hum Investments Ltd
El Marcelago, LLC
Lars Property Investments LLC

Edwin,
Go to EDITREPLACE
Under the Replace tab in "Find what: type Llc In Replace with: type
LLC
click the options button lower right and select Match case and make
sure Match entire cell contents is not selected.
